The Meike EFTR-071XL Lens Locking Mount Adapter is an excellent tool for photographers and videographers looking to expand the versatility of their Canon EF lenses on Canon APS-C cameras like the EOS R10 or R7. The adapter’s speed booster functionality is a standout feature, increasing the aperture by 1 f-stop, which enhances light intake and creates stunning bokeh, making it ideal for portrait and cinematic shots.The build quality is solid, with a durable metal construction that is resistant to water and dust—perfect for outdoor shoots. At only 163g, it’s lightweight and portable, so it doesn’t add bulk to your camera setup. The electronic contacts support autofocus and vibration compensation, ensuring seamless integration with EF series lenses.One unique feature is the gasket adjustment option, allowing fine-tuning of the focus distance if needed. While this adds versatility, beginners might find it slightly tricky to get the hang of at first.Overall, this lens adapter is a must-have for Canon users who want to get more out of their EF lenses on APS-C cameras. It’s particularly useful for creating sharp, vibrant images with enhanced background separation and for professionals looking for precision and reliability in various shooting conditions.

Aftermarket adapters are not always the best with performance and compatibility with certain camera bodies, and manufacturers, but Meike has done a great job here at producing a very good compatible speed booster for super 35 R bodies from Canon. I personally am using it with my Canon R7, and really appreciate the ability to have a wider field of view, and most importantly an extra stop of light using EF lenses. It's so nice to have the opportunity to take better advantage of more of the full focal length of so many great EF lenses. I personally love picking up some older EF lenses, because I find they have great character and image rendering, compared to even some of the newer RF ones out there. So, having an affordable speed booster option to be able to get the wider field of view, and an extra stop of light, is a great option to expand the versatility of my R7. Especially when you consider the speed booster from Canon is so expensive, it's nice to have an option that works really well, and has been reliable with its connectivity and compatibility to Canon, at about half the price. The optics are very clean, and I didn't notice any sort of degradation of image quality because of the speed booster. It also works pretty well with the autofocus, and EF lenses that have autofocus. You have a USB-C port for firmware updates. The lens mounting system is a little different, in that you have to turn the ring on the speed booster to lock the lens in place, as opposed to turning the lens which is what I'm normally used to. It's neither good or bad really, it's just different. All in all, the performance to value ratio is very high. It's a great option for people with super 35 sensors, who want to take advantage of the larger field of view offered by EF lenses. I haven't had any hiccups with it so far, and for the price, I'd certainly recommend it.
